Call for Jury Members

 

Podcast and Song Student Contest Make it Heard 2026 invites musicians, songwriters, singers, music producers, audio engineers, voice actors, radio & podcast producers,  teachers in the field of Media Education, public and private stakeholders across Europe and beyond to participate in the Contest’s Jury.

We are looking for professionals who care about children and youth and who can allocate a few hours of their time to listen and evaluate students’ submissions to the Contest. Professionals from Croatia, Cyprus, France, Germany, Greece, and Spain are especially encouraged to apply. 

In this year’s Contest, students are called to work together and harness their creativity by producing a podcast or a song on a theme of their own choosing. Teachers/ educators can submit the students’ podcasts, from 7 to 10 minutes, and songs up to 4 minutes until January 23rd, 2026.

Entries will be evaluated by participating schools and by two Jury Committees of professional members.

Up to three prizes will be awarded for each of the two submission categories (podcast, song) and each of the four student age groups (kindergarten to high school). Also, one Audience Award for each submission category will be announced through online voting.

Interested professionals can apply online via the Jury application form until December 20, 2025. 

All applicants will be notified, if they have a seat in the Jury for one of the submission categories. Jury members will then have about three weeks to cast their votes through an online system, evaluating about 10 to 20 submissions each. 

All submissions, regardless of the results, will be broadcast on the European School Radio program.

Furthermore, students will be able to present their productions during the 10th European School Radio Festival, which will be hosted in Corfu in Greece from 22nd to 25th of April 2026. 

🎤 The Award Ceremony for the Song Category will take place on Wednesday, April 22, 2026, at 18:00 at the Municipal and Regional Theatre of Corfu.

🎧 The Award Ceremony for the Podcast Category will be held on Saturday, April 25, 2026, at 10:00 at the Ionian Academy.

Jury members are encouraged to participate in the 4-day Festival event and present one of the awards during the Ceremonies.
